Project Respect is support for women trafficked for sexual exploitation and women in the sex industry. We assist women one-on-one, create a safe community and advocate for women's rights. We exist because women matter. We are a non-profit, feminist, community-based organisation.
To support women, Project Respect works in three ways:
One, we assist women one-on-one and help them access essential services - such as healthcare and legal representation. Guided entirely by the needs of women, we place no limits on the length or type of support offered. Two, we connect women together - supporting them to support each other. Our lunches and weekends away are safe and non-judgemental - rare spaces where women are welcomed, understood and treated with respect. Three, we advocate for women's rights against violence, trafficking and exploitation. We lobby all levels of government, and offer women a platform to speak - knowing their voices and leadership will create the positive change we seek.
At Project Respect, we believe that all women have the right to feel safe and respected. To achieve a world free from sexual exploitation we are committed to doing what others can't.
